Don't stress about not getting the Bose system--I have it and it's not all that great. My '98 Mustang with a Kenwood deck and 4 Infinity Reference 6x8s sounded better. Just save your pennies and redo the audio system with good stuff when you get the chance.
#5
To be fair, the Bose system was a package upgrade, not the base system (at least it was in my '06). It's not stellar, though. There's an audio industry saying "No highs, no lows--must be Bose." They're just really good at marketing.
Honestly, you'll probably be better off without it if you want to upgrade later. Bose has a really odd rear deck speaker that I don't know if anyone makes anything off-the-shelf to replace it.

I have the bose in my current b7, and had the basic system in my old one. The bose is definitely a little better, but only a little, and the bass is just simply NOT ENOUGH. what were they thinking? My dad's VW with his stock Dynaudio (600-700W) kicks the Bose's butt into the middle of last century. You should NOT be sorry that you don't have it. Just get a decent aftermarket one.
